龙空技术网

使用Spring Boot快速搭建一个WEB项目,实现两个数相加的功能

堇俞 236

前言:

现时你们对“web功能实现”都比较关怀,咱们都想要了解一些“web功能实现”的相关文章。那么小编也在网上收集了一些对于“web功能实现””的相关内容,希望朋友们能喜欢,看官们快快来学习一下吧!

本文目标

本文主要是让大家体验一下Spring Boot框架是如何使用的,我们会从中发现搭建一个WEB工程是多么容易的一件事!

需求

输入一个a,输入一个b,输出a+b的结果

步骤

引入依赖

这里使用一个之前建好的项目:为学习Spring Boot做准备,创建一个父级POM文件

<?xml version="1.0" encoding="UTF-8"?><project xmlns="" xmlns:xsi=""	xsi:schemaLocation=" ">		<modelVersion>4.0.0</modelVersion>	<artifactId>springboot-web</artifactId>	<packaging>jar</packaging>	<parent>		<groupId>com.wyh</groupId>		<artifactId>spring-boot</artifactId>		<version>0.0.1-SNAPSHOT</version>	</parent></project>

编写main方法

这里是我们的启动类,完成后运行main方法即可

import org.springframework.boot.SpringApplication;import org.springframework.boot.autoconfigure.SpringBootApplication;@SpringBootApplicationpublic class SpringbootWebApplication {	public static void main(String[] args) {		SpringApplication.run(SpringbootWebApplication.class, args);	}}

编写Controller

import org.springframework.web.bind.annotation.GetMapping;import org.springframework.web.bind.annotation.RequestMapping;import org.springframework.web.bind.annotation.RestController;@RestController@RequestMapping("cal")public class CalController {		@GetMapping("add")	public int add(int a, int b) {		return a + b;	}	}
结果

浏览器中输入地址:;b=2

预期结果:5

标签: #web功能实现